Understanding ADHD: Causes, Diagnosis, Treatment

Attention-deficit/hyperactivity disorder (ADHD) is a neurodevelopmental disorder characterized by persistent patterns of inattention, hyperactivity, and impulsivity that interfere with daily functioning and development. It commonly manifests in childhood and can continue into adulthood. ADHD is one of the most prevalent childhood disorders, affecting around 5-7% of children globally, with significant variations across different populations.

The exact causes of ADHD are not fully understood, but a combination of genetic, environmental, and neurobiological factors is believed to contribute to its development. Genetic studies have shown that ADHD tends to run in families, suggesting a hereditary component. Environmental factors such as prenatal exposure to toxins (e.g., alcohol, tobacco smoke, certain medications) and maternal stress during pregnancy may also increase the risk of ADHD. Additionally, abnormalities in brain structure and function, particularly involving regions responsible for attention, impulse control, and executive functioning, have been observed in individuals with ADHD.

The diagnosis of ADHD is typically made based on clinical assessment, which involves evaluating the child’s symptoms, developmental history, and functional impairment. The Diagnostic and Statistical Manual of Mental Disorders (DSM-5), published by the American Psychiatric Association, provides criteria for diagnosing ADHD, including the presence of specific symptoms and their impact on daily life.

There are three subtypes of ADHD recognized by the DSM-5:

  1. Predominantly inattentive presentation: Characterized by difficulties with sustained attention, organization, and follow-through on tasks, without significant hyperactivity-impulsivity.
  2. Predominantly hyperactive-impulsive presentation: Marked by excessive motor activity, restlessness, and impulsivity, with fewer symptoms of inattention.
  3. Combined presentation: Involves both inattentive and hyperactive-impulsive symptoms.

Treatment approaches for ADHD typically involve a combination of behavioral interventions, psychoeducation, and medication, tailored to the individual’s needs and circumstances. Behavioral therapy aims to teach children and their families strategies for managing ADHD symptoms, improving organization, time management, and social skills, and addressing any coexisting difficulties such as anxiety or learning disorders.

Medication is often recommended for moderate to severe cases of ADHD, particularly when symptoms significantly impair functioning. Stimulant medications, such as methylphenidate (e.g., Ritalin) and amphetamine (e.g., Adderall), are commonly prescribed and have been shown to effectively reduce symptoms of inattention, hyperactivity, and impulsivity in many individuals with ADHD. Non-stimulant medications, such as atomoxetine (Strattera) and guanfacine (Intuniv), may be considered as alternatives, especially for those who do not respond well to stimulants or have contraindications to their use.

It’s important to note that medication alone is not sufficient for managing ADHD; it should be used as part of a comprehensive treatment plan that includes behavioral interventions and support. Regular monitoring and adjustment of treatment are essential to ensure optimal symptom management and minimize side effects.

In recent years, there has been growing interest in alternative and complementary approaches to managing ADHD, such as dietary modifications, mindfulness-based practices, neurofeedback, and exercise. While some individuals may find these interventions helpful as adjuncts to traditional treatments, their efficacy remains subject to debate, and more research is needed to establish their effectiveness.

Parental involvement and support are crucial components of ADHD management, as families play a central role in implementing behavioral strategies, monitoring medication effects, and advocating for their child’s needs in educational and social settings. Education about ADHD, its impact on functioning, and available resources can help empower families to navigate the challenges associated with the disorder and access appropriate support services.

In educational settings, accommodations and modifications may be necessary to support students with ADHD, such as preferential seating, extended time on tests, and breaks for movement or relaxation. Individualized education plans (IEPs) or 504 plans can formalize these accommodations and outline specific goals and strategies to address the student’s needs.

Epidemiology: ADHD is one of the most common neurodevelopmental disorders in childhood, with prevalence estimates varying globally. While it affects approximately 5-7% of children worldwide, prevalence rates may differ across countries and cultures. For example, studies in the United States have reported higher prevalence rates compared to some European countries. ADHD is diagnosed more frequently in boys than in girls, with a male-to-female ratio ranging from 2:1 to 4:1, although this disparity may be less pronounced in adults. The disorder often persists into adolescence and adulthood, with estimates suggesting that 30-60% of children with ADHD will continue to experience symptoms in adulthood.

Etiology: The etiology of ADHD is multifactorial, involving complex interactions between genetic, environmental, and neurobiological factors. Family and twin studies have provided strong evidence for a genetic contribution to ADHD, with heritability estimates ranging from 70-80%. Genome-wide association studies (GWAS) have identified several genes associated with ADHD, many of which are involved in neurotransmitter systems implicated in attention, impulse control, and reward processing. Environmental factors, such as prenatal exposure to toxins (e.g., alcohol, tobacco smoke, lead), maternal stress during pregnancy, low birth weight, and premature birth, may also increase the risk of ADHD. Neuroimaging studies have revealed structural and functional differences in brain regions implicated in ADHD, including the prefrontal cortex, basal ganglia, and cerebellum.

Clinical Presentation: ADHD is characterized by a persistent pattern of inattention, hyperactivity, and impulsivity that is inconsistent with the individual’s developmental level and interferes with functioning in multiple settings, such as home, school, and social contexts. Inattentive symptoms may include difficulty sustaining attention, organizing tasks, following instructions, and completing assignments. Hyperactive-impulsive symptoms may manifest as excessive motor activity, restlessness, fidgeting, interrupting others, and difficulty waiting turns. The presentation of ADHD can vary widely among individuals and may change over time, leading to diagnostic challenges.

Diagnosis: The diagnosis of ADHD is based on clinical assessment, which involves gathering information from multiple sources, including parents, teachers, and the child. The Diagnostic and Statistical Manual of Mental Disorders (DSM-5) provides criteria for diagnosing ADHD, including specific symptoms, onset before age 12, and impairment in multiple domains of functioning. Differential diagnosis is essential to rule out other conditions that may present with similar symptoms, such as anxiety disorders, mood disorders, learning disabilities, and sensory processing disorders. Comprehensive evaluation may include standardized rating scales, behavioral observations, developmental history, and psychoeducational testing.

Treatment Modalities: Treatment approaches for ADHD are multimodal and typically include a combination of behavioral interventions, psychoeducation, and medication. Behavioral therapy aims to teach children and their families strategies for managing ADHD symptoms, improving organizational skills, and addressing coexisting difficulties. Parent training programs, such as behavioral parent training (BPT) and parent-child interaction therapy (PCIT), focus on enhancing parenting skills and promoting positive parent-child relationships. School-based interventions, such as classroom accommodations and behavioral interventions, can help support academic success and social functioning. Medication is often recommended for moderate to severe cases of ADHD, with stimulant medications (e.g., methylphenidate, amphetamine) being the most commonly prescribed. Non-stimulant medications, such as atomoxetine and guanfacine, may be considered as alternatives, particularly for individuals who do not respond well to stimulants or have contraindications to their use. It’s important to note that medication should be used as part of a comprehensive treatment plan that includes behavioral interventions and support.

Impact on Individuals and Society: ADHD can have significant consequences for individuals and society, affecting academic achievement, occupational functioning, social relationships, and overall quality of life. Children with ADHD may experience academic difficulties, behavioral problems, peer rejection, and low self-esteem, which can persist into adulthood if left untreated. Adults with ADHD may struggle with employment, financial management, interpersonal relationships, and mental health issues, such as depression and anxiety. The economic burden of ADHD is substantial, including direct costs related to healthcare utilization and indirect costs associated with productivity loss and educational underachievement. Early identification and intervention, along with ongoing support and accommodations, are crucial for minimizing the long-term impact of ADHD and promoting positive outcomes for affected individuals.
